a line through (-2,7) and (-8,-3) has slope =
(7--3)/(-2--8) = 10/6 = 5/3
perpendicular lines have the negative inverse slope = -3/5
change the sign and flip the fraction upside down
y=mx + b
y=-3x/5 + b
plug in the midpoint to calculate b, the midpoint is the average of the coordinates: (-5, 2)
average x coordinate = (-2-8)/2 = -10/2 =-5
average y coordinate = (7-3)/2 = 4/2 = 2
2 =-3(-5)/5 + b
b = 2-3 =-1
the perpendicular line has the equation
y=-3x/5 -1
or
5y =-3x -5
or
3x +5y +-5
It may help to plot the points and and graph the lines
even a rough sketch can help.
